Thyroid nodules, a common clinical finding, are often benign but can sometimes indicate malignancy. As healthcare professionals, understanding the essentials of thyroid nodule evaluation is crucial to provide optimal patient care.
Thyroid nodules are detected in 4-7% of the population via palpation, but the incidence increases to 19-67% when evaluated using ultrasonography. Risk factors include age, radiation exposure, iodine deficiency, and female gender. A family history of thyroid cancer also increases risk.
Diagnostic tools include physical examination, thyroid function tests, and imaging studies. Ultrasonography is the preferred imaging modality due to its high sensitivity and specificity. It can provide information on nodule size, composition, echogenicity, and the presence of suspicious features.
The American Thyroid Association (ATA) has provided a risk stratification system based on ultrasonographic features. This helps guide the need for fine-needle aspiration (FNA) biopsy. Highly suspicious features include microcalcifications, irregular margins, taller-than-wide shape, and marked hypoechogenicity.
FNA biopsy is the gold standard for evaluating thyroid nodules. It is a safe, cost-effective, and minimally invasive procedure. The Bethesda System for Reporting Thyroid Cytopathology offers a standardized approach to reporting FNA results, aiding in clinical decision-making.
Management options range from surveillance to surgery, depending on the nodule's size, ultrasonographic characteristics, FNA results, and patient preference. Thyroid hormone suppression therapy is no longer routinely recommended.
Thyroid nodule evaluation is a complex process that requires a comprehensive understanding of risk factors, diagnostic tools, and management options. By staying abreast of the latest guidelines and research, healthcare professionals can ensure optimal outcomes for their patients.
